Career
He started with cabaret. He was discovered in 1964 by writer and comedian
Jaap Van de Merwe. After seeing him perform in Amsterdam, Van der Merwe hired him and made him participate as pianist to his performances.
After his collaboration with Van de Merwe, he worked with
Wim Kan

and
Henk Elsink, among others. Thereafter he was active in music, singing and acting. In 1971 he was awarded a
Zilveren Harp for his contribution to the Dutch song.
Lambrechts was a contributor to the satirical radio program ''Cursief'' in the early 1970s.
From November 1984 to December 1993 Lambrechts was ''
Hoofdpiet'' in television programs about
Sinterklaas

. He later gave up portraying the character, which was taken over by
Erik de Vogel. Between 1991 and 2010 he dubbed
Tigger
